Some highbank DMA masters can support coherent (ACP) or non-coherent DMA. This sets up dma_map_ops for masters which are configured for coherent DMA. Signed-off-by: Rob Herring <rob.herring@calxeda.com> Signed-off-by: Marek Szyprowski <m.szyprowski@samsung.com>

* AHCI SATA Controller
|
|
|
|
SATA nodes are defined to describe on-chip Serial ATA controllers.
|
|
Each SATA controller should have its own node.
|
|
|
|
Required properties:
|
|
- compatible : compatible list, contains "calxeda,hb-ahci" or "snps,spear-ahci"
|
|
- interrupts : <interrupt mapping for SATA IRQ>
|
|
- reg : <registers mapping>
|
|
|
|
Optional properties:
|
|
- dma-coherent : Present if dma operations are coherent
|
|
|
|
Example:
|
|
sata@ffe08000 {
|
|
compatible = "calxeda,hb-ahci";
|
|
reg = <0xffe08000 0x1000>;
|
|
interrupts = <115>;
|
|
};
